The global endocrine testing market size is expected to reach USD 21.42 billion by 2030, registering a CAGR of 8.5%
The increasing prevalence of lifestyle-related diseases such as diabetes and thyroid-related obesity not only among adults but also among the elderly population has increased the need for endocrine testing. This awareness towards better health is contributing significantly to the growth of the global endocrine testing market, as regular endocrine testing of an individual helps in maintaining overall health.
According to WHO statistics, more than 39 million children under the age of five were overweight or obese in 2020. A sedentary lifestyle and unhealthy food choices contribute to obesity and diabetes in the general population. The occurrence of such pathologies has also prompted much research into metabolic function and related hormonal disorders.
Funding from governments and private organizations has also motivated the scientific community. For example, NIH's NIDDK (National Institute of Diabetes and Digestive and Kidney Diseases) promotes many sponsored research programs aimed at increasing our understanding of disease and improving health. One such initiative by NIDDK is his September 2022 Mid-Atlantic Symposium for Diabetes and Obesity Research. This enables the exchange and exchange of scientific knowledge and enables cooperation at the regional level. Such efforts will advance the understanding of the endocrine functions of the human body and further enable the growth of the endocrine testing market.
Lack of awareness in underdeveloped and developing countries is expected to slow down the growth of the endocrine testing market. Due to the development of the healthcare environment and lack of reimbursement models, people in these regions have limited access to regular endocrine testing. However, testing frequency is expected to increase in these countries as awareness of healthy systems increases during the COVID-19 pandemic.
The coronavirus disease (COVID-19) outbreak has created favorable opportunities for the application of endocrine testing. COVID-19 causes a systemic disease that damages many organs. Therefore, metabolic and hormonal disorders are common in these patients, leading to an increase in endocrine studies.
Additionally, the travel restrictions and restrictions due to the lockdown also facilitated digital platforms for medical consultations and home specimen collection services. The availability of point-of-care devices and kits for detecting hormone levels at home is also driving the growth of the overall endocrine testing market.

Endocrine Testing Market Report Highlights
-
By test type, the thyroid stimulating hormone (TSH) testing segment led the market, accounting for the largest revenue share of 28.0% in 2023. The increasing prevalence of thyroid disease and increased awareness of early detection has increased the demand for TSH testing.
-
By technology, the tandem mass spectrometry segment accounted for the largest revenue share of 24.5% in 2023. This is because it is often used in conjunction with liquid chromatography and helps to obtain more accurate results.
-
By end-user, private laboratories are estimated to register the fastest CAGR from 2024 to 2030. Outsourcing of diagnostic services, cost-effectiveness, and specialized testing capabilities are contributing to the growth of endocrine testing in private laboratories.
-
North America generated the highest revenue for the endocrine testing market in 2023. This is thought to be due to the high prevalence of thyroid disease, diabetes, and obesity within the U.S. population. Additionally, medical developments and increased spending patterns in the region also led to higher revenues.
